Output 8c34de80b3ad920d64fc1076fc49e0a009e36f5fd801d3e56b52e838de079d8f:8

value
13210878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bb293f29c9156d40027bcc7b5af510f62481af2 OP_EQUAL
address
35g4ubypy9SBwU3bmxxAWv1W1R7dBh7c3B
transaction
8c34de80b3ad920d64fc1076fc49e0a009e36f5fd801d3e56b52e838de079d8f
spent
true